🔹 1. Nikon Z6 III – Best Overall Hybrid Camera

Nikon Z6 III | Full-Frame mirrorless Stills/Video Camera with 6K/60p Internal RAW Recording | Nikon USA Model
  • VIDEO – 6K/60p Internal N-RAW video recording + oversampled 4K UHD, 4K/120p, Full HD/240p slow motion, Hi-Res Zoom up to 2x digital zoom during HD recording, 1.4x during 4K recording, line-in audio, professional monitoring tools and more.

The Nikon Z6 III is a powerhouse for creators who demand professional stills and cinematic video in one package. With its 24.5MP full-frame sensor and the ability to shoot 6K/60p internal RAW video, it bridges the gap between photography and filmmaking.

It also packs AI-powered autofocus, IBIS (in-body image stabilization), and a robust Z-mount lens ecosystem, making it the best hybrid camera in 2026.

Key Specs:

  • Sensor: 24.5MP Full-Frame CMOS
  • Video: 6K/60p RAW + 4K/120p slow motion
  • Autofocus: Eye/Animal AF with AI tracking
  • ISO: 100–51,200 (expandable)
  • Weight: ~710g
  • Mount: Nikon Z-Mount

Real-World Performance:

  • Video: Crisp 6K RAW for cinematic filmmaking.
  • Photography: Excellent low-light performance, accurate colors.
  • Action Shots: AI AF locks onto eyes & moving subjects flawlessly.

Pros:

  • 6K/60p RAW video = future-proof.
  • Excellent hybrid performance.
  • Pro-grade autofocus tracking.
  • Compatible with wide range of Nikon Z lenses.

Cons:

  • More expensive than entry-level models.
  • Slightly heavier than Canon EOS RP.

🔹 2. Canon EOS RP Kit – Best Budget Full-Frame for Travel & Beginners

Sale
Canon EOS RP Full-Frame Mirrorless Interchangeable Lens Camera +…
  • Compact, Lightweight and High-Quality RF Lens with a Versatile Zoom Range of 24-105 millimeter
  • Optical Image Stabilization at up to 5 stops of shake correction

The Canon EOS RP is the most affordable full-frame mirrorless camera on the market, making it perfect for beginners and travelers. Despite its lower price, it delivers 26.2MP full-frame quality, 4K video, and a lightweight design that makes it ideal for vlogging and on-the-go shooting.

It comes with the RF24-105mm lens kit, giving you a versatile starter lens for landscapes, portraits, and travel shots.

Key Specs:

  • Sensor: 26.2MP Full-Frame CMOS
  • Video: 4K/24p
  • Autofocus: Dual Pixel AF with Eye Detection
  • Lens: RF24-105mm included
  • Weight: ~485g (lightest in class)

Real-World Performance:

  • Travel: Easy to carry, perfect for vlogging & landscapes.
  • Beginner-Friendly: Intuitive touchscreen menus.
  • Image Quality: Excellent sharpness for portraits & travel photos.

Pros:

  • Affordable entry into full-frame.
  • Compact and lightweight.
  • Comes with versatile lens kit.
  • Great for travel, blogging, vlogging.

Cons:

  • Limited 4K (cropped, only 24p).
  • Not as fast as Nikon Z6 III or Sony a7 III.

🔹 3. Sony a7 III Kit – Best All-Rounder with Huge Lens Ecosystem

Sale
Sony a7 III (ILCEM3K/B) Full-frame Mirrorless Interchangeable-Lens…
  • Advanced 24.2MP BSI Full-frame Image Sensor w/ 1.8X readout speed Advanced 24.2MP Back-Illuminated 35mm Full-frame Image Sensor
  • 15-stop dynamic range, 14-bit uncompressed RAW, ISO 50 to 204,800

The Sony a7 III is a legend in the mirrorless world—known for its balance of performance, price, and lens support. With 24.2MP resolution, 4K HDR video, and unmatched low-light performance, it remains a top choice in 2026.

Sony’s E-mount lens ecosystem is the most extensive among mirrorless systems, giving photographers and videographers the most flexibility.

Key Specs:

  • Sensor: 24.2MP Full-Frame Exmor R CMOS
  • Video: 4K HDR (30p) + 120fps slow motion
  • Autofocus: 693-point phase detection + Eye AF
  • Lens: 28-70mm kit lens included
  • Weight: ~650g

Real-World Performance:

  • Photography: Stunning dynamic range, excellent portraits.
  • Video: Sharp 4K HDR with great low-light performance.
  • Versatility: Great for weddings, events, travel, and YouTube.

Pros:

  • Balanced performance for all needs.
  • Industry-leading lens ecosystem.
  • Excellent low-light shooting.
  • Reliable Eye AF for portraits & video.

Cons:

  • No 6K video like Nikon Z6 III.
  • Slightly older design compared to latest Sony models.

❓ FAQs: Best Full-Frame Mirrorless Cameras 2026

Q1: Is full-frame worth it over APS-C?
Yes—full-frame sensors offer better low-light, higher detail, and shallow depth of field.

Q2: Which is the best camera for vlogging?
Canon EOS RP is the lightest and most travel-friendly.

Q3: Can I use DSLR lenses on mirrorless cameras?
Yes—with adapters (Canon EF → RF, Nikon F → Z, Sony A → E).

Q4: Which camera has the best video features?
Nikon Z6 III with 6K/60p RAW video.

Q5: Is the Sony a7 III still worth buying in 2026?
Yes—it’s still one of the best all-rounders with a huge lens ecosystem.
